윈도우11에서 파워빌더12.5 사용시 오류
현재 당사에서는 PowerBuilder 12.5 버전으로 개발된 프로그램을 사용 중입니다.
Microsoft의 Windows 10 지원 종료(2025년 10월 14일) 에 따라 현재 사용중인 PowerBuilder 프로그램의 호환성 문제를 확인하고 있습니다.
Windows 11 환경에서 해당 프로그램을 테스트한 결과 아래와 같은 주요 이슈가 발생하여 전환 시 업무 차질이 우려되는 상황입니다.
이에 따라 다음 사항에 대해 문의드립니다.
1. PowerBuilder 12.5 기반 프로그램의 Windows 11 지원 가능 여부
2. 발생 가능한 호환성 문제에 대한 해결 방안 또는 지원 방안
l 이슈사항
n 프로그램이 메모리를 1000MB 이상 사용 시 c0000005 또는 c0000004 메모리 오류로 잦은 crash 발생
- 호환성 모드를 사용하더라도 해결 안되고 메모리 참조 오류 발생합니다.
n 많은 데이터 조회 시 비교적 메모리를 적게 사용 하더라도 300MB 이상, 실제 조회건수가 낮더라도 쿼리 시간 or 이벤트 부하에 따라 잦은 freeze 발생
- 해당 프로그램 윈도우7 호환성 모드시 대부분 해결됨 ( 간혈적으로 증상 발생 가능 )
n 일반적으로 Windows 10과 비교해 이벤트 발생 시 높은 지연 시간
- 해당 프로그램 윈도우7 호환성 모드시 대부분 해결됨 ( 간혈적으로 증상 발생 가능 )
n 64bit환경의 32bit 어플리케이션 디버깅으로 인한 (0x4000001f) 잦은 appcrash 발생
- 해당 프로그램 윈도우7 호환성 모드시 대부분 해결됨 ( 간혈적으로 증상 발생 가능 )
l 오류 로그
오류 있는 응용 프로그램 이름: PB125.EXE, 버전: 12.5.0.2511, 타임스탬프로: 0x4e114b2a
오류 있는 모듈 이름: PBVM125.dll, 버전: 12.5.0.2511, 타임스탬프: 0x4e158288
예외 코드: 0xc0000005
오류 오프셋: 0x00179546
오류 처리 ID: 0x4548
오류 응용 프로그램 시작 시간: 0x1DC293EA760045B
Faulting 응용 프로그램 경로: C:\Program Files (x86)\Sybase\PowerBuilder 12.5\PB125.EXE
Faulting 모듈 경로: C:\Program Files (x86)\Sybase\Shared\PowerBuilder\PBVM125.dll
Report Id: e393b226-391c-47d9-a9a7-3c38c16f774d
Faulting 패키지 전체 이름:
Faulting 패키지 상대 응용 프로그램 ID:
응용 프로그램: PB125.EXE
Framework 버전: v4.0.30319
설명: 처리되지 않은 예외로 인해 프로세스가 종료되었습니다.
예외 정보:예외 코드 c0000005, 예외 주소 00DD9546
스택:
오류 버킷 1400759508515785415, 유형 5
이벤트 이름: RADAR_PRE_LEAK_WOW64
응답: 사용할 수 없음
Cab ID: 0
문제 서명:
P1: PB125.EXE
P2: 12.5.0.2511
P3: 10.0.26100.2.0.0
P4:
P5:
P6:
P7:
P8:
P9:
P10:
첨부 파일:
\?\C:\Users\오혜인\AppData\Local\Temp\RDR291F.tmp\empty.txt
\?\C:\ProgramData\Microsoft\Windows\WER\Temp\WER.f48cc0f1-d111-44bf-bbab-004f97f7c1e5.tmp.WERInternalMetadata.xml
WPR_initiated_DiagTrackMiniLogger_OneTrace_User_Logger_20250917_1_EC_0_inject.etl
\?\C:\ProgramData\Microsoft\Windows\WER\Temp\WER.c7029c69-36d0-46e6-b267-9d47f804433a.tmp.etl
WPR_initiated_DiagTrackMiniLogger_WPR System Collector_inject.etl
\?\C:\ProgramData\Microsoft\Windows\WER\Temp\WER.81133ac7-fc5c-41db-8040-b654d0327414.tmp.etl
\?\C:\ProgramData\Microsoft\Windows\WER\Temp\WER.130bb68a-bc22-4480-9c8d-8a8162ef546a.tmp.csv
\?\C:\ProgramData\Microsoft\Windows\WER\Temp\WER.494fb0ad-25ca-4547-a750-cf5a765691ea.tmp.txt
\?\C:\ProgramData\Microsoft\Windows\WER\Temp\WER.427ea64e-d3d0-4218-9f51-04d9eeac7a27.tmp.xml
이 파일은 다음에서 사용할 수 있습니다.
NULL
분석 기호:
해결 방법 재확인: 0
보고서 ID: cb84f425-ada8-4b94-84b1-71d44fc95353
보고서 상태: 268435456
해시된 패킷: a2245f697af98587b3707f59f8d58ac7
Cab Guid: 0
=====================================================================================================================================
오류 있는 응용 프로그램 이름: pc_dist.exe, 버전: 1.0.0.1, 타임스탬프로: 0x4e114ae4
오류 있는 모듈 이름: PBSHR125.dll, 버전: 12.5.0.2511, 타임스탬프: 0x4e114ae6
예외 코드: 0x4000001f
오류 오프셋: 0x000f0199
오류 처리 ID: 0x61D0
오류 응용 프로그램 시작 시간: 0x1DC2B68CCB1641C
Faulting 응용 프로그램 경로: C:\Powercerv Applications\Distribution\Dist\pc_dist.exe
Faulting 모듈 경로: C:\Powercerv Applications\Distribution\Dist\PBSHR125.dll
Report Id: c1380099-b8e5-4964-877b-da1e4138c258
Faulting 패키지 전체 이름:
Faulting 패키지 상대 응용 프로그램 ID:
오류 버킷 , 유형 0
이벤트 이름: APPCRASH
응답: 사용할 수 없음
Cab ID: 0
문제 서명:
P1: pc_dist.exe
P2: 1.0.0.1
P3: 4e114ae4
P4: PBSHR125.dll
P5: 12.5.0.2511
P6: 4e114ae6
P7: 4000001f
P8: 000f0199
P9:
P10:
첨부 파일:
\?\C:\ProgramData\Microsoft\Windows\WER\Temp\WER.3f9f7d77-8ebe-4c35-b094-79a9a398c1d1.tmp.mdmp
\?\C:\ProgramData\Microsoft\Windows\WER\Temp\WER.b517b56c-b9f5-4597-86a3-241afd9f341e.tmp.WERInternalMetadata.xml
\?\C:\ProgramData\Microsoft\Windows\WER\ReportQueue\AppCrash_pc_dist.exe_b046467145c73f2b3a7476bbf2e18157853612_50b73fe5_cab_a9c9c3de-dbbd-47f9-b841-e6b4801386a3\WPR_initiated_DiagTrackMiniLogger_OneTrace_User_Logger_20250917_1_EC_0_inject.etl
\?\C:\ProgramData\Microsoft\Windows\WER\Temp\WER.ca6df7fe-3080-4870-bab3-36de41d82998.tmp.etl
\?\C:\ProgramData\Microsoft\Windows\WER\ReportQueue\AppCrash_pc_dist.exe_b046467145c73f2b3a7476bbf2e18157853612_50b73fe5_cab_a9c9c3de-dbbd-47f9-b841-e6b4801386a3\WPR_initiated_DiagTrackMiniLogger_WPR System Collector_inject.etl
\?\C:\ProgramData\Microsoft\Windows\WER\Temp\WER.8b56bf6c-8cdb-43f6-8cd6-f4e63c5e0af0.tmp.etl
\?\C:\ProgramData\Microsoft\Windows\WER\Temp\WER.b3dae2f5-7d5b-48c7-be2a-2a51c88682e6.tmp.csv
\?\C:\ProgramData\Microsoft\Windows\WER\Temp\WER.ac978787-fd86-498f-bf20-e9e18f6279eb.tmp.txt
\?\C:\ProgramData\Microsoft\Windows\WER\Temp\WER.5092fe39-a8ac-495b-89d4-89b5da1af2b3.tmp.xml
\?\C:\Users\오혜인\AppData\Local\Temp\WER.81c1b7fd-9eea-44b7-b109-9862feb83d26.tmp.appcompat.txt
\?\C:\ProgramData\Microsoft\Windows\WER\ReportQueue\AppCrash_pc_dist.exe_b046467145c73f2b3a7476bbf2e18157853612_50b73fe5_cab_a9c9c3de-dbbd-47f9-b841-e6b4801386a3\memory.hdmp
이 파일은 다음에서 사용할 수 있습니다.
\?\C:\ProgramData\Microsoft\Windows\WER\ReportQueue\AppCrash_pc_dist.exe_b046467145c73f2b3a7476bbf2e18157853612_50b73fe5_cab_a9c9c3de-dbbd-47f9-b841-e6b4801386a3
분석 기호:
해결 방법